    Observations of downwelling far-infrared emission at Table Mountain California made by the FIRST instrument

    Get PDF
    AbstractThe Far-Infrared Spectroscopy of the Troposphere (FIRST) instrument measured downwelling far-infrared (far-IR) and mid-infrared (mid-IR) atmospheric spectra from 200 to 800cm−1 at Table Mountain, California (elevation 2285m). Spectra were recorded during a field campaign conducted in early autumn 2012, subsequent to a detailed laboratory calibration of the instrument. Radiosondes launched coincident with the FIRST observations provide temperature and water vapor profiles for model simulation of the measured spectra. Results from the driest day of the campaign (October 19, with less than 3mm precipitable water) are presented here. Considerable spectral development is observed between 400 and 600cm−1. Over 90% of the measured radiance in this interval originates within 2.8km of the surface. The existence of temperature inversions close to the surface necessitates atmospheric layer thicknesses as fine as 10m in the radiative transfer model calculations. A detailed assessment of the uncertainties in the FIRST measurements and in the model calculations shows that the measured radiances agree with the model radiance calculations to within their combined uncertainties. The uncertainties in modeled radiance are shown to be larger than the measurement uncertainties. Overall, the largest source of uncertainty is in the water vapor concentration used in the radiative transfer calculations. Proposed new instruments with markedly higher measurement accuracy than FIRST will be able to measure the far-IR spectrum to much greater accuracy than it can be computed. As such, accurate direct measurements of the far-IR, and not solely calculations, are essential to the assessment of climate change

    Experience and results after the implementation of a radiology day unit in a reference hospital

    Get PDF
    Hospitals; Radiology (Interventional); Surveys and questionariesHospitals; Radiologia (intervencionista); Enquestes i preguntesHospitales; Radiología (Intervencionista); Encuestas y cuestionariosBackground Interventional radiological procedures have significantly increased in recent years. Most of them are minimally invasive and require a short hospitalization, mainly done in other non-radiological units nowadays. Limited bed availability and high occupancy rates in these units create longer waiting lists and cancellations. The aim of this retrospective study is to assess the creation and functioning of a Radiology Day Unit (RDU) and evaluating its outcomes. For this purpose, data about interventional procedures and its complications, incidents, patient safety, quality and satisfaction rates were collected from May 2018 to December 2020, and posteriorly analyzed to evaluate its implementation. Results During the assessed period, 3841 patients were admitted into the RDU, with a net increase of 13% and 26% in the second and third year, respectively. Procedures performed by the Abdominal Radiology section were the most frequent (76–85%) followed by Interventional Vascular Radiology and Thoracic Radiology. Complication rates were low (1.5%) and most of them were self-limited and managed in the own department. Waiting lists were significantly reduced, from 2 months to 1 week in case of procedures performed by the Abdominal Radiology section. Patient satisfaction was higher than 80% in all the items evaluated with a global satisfaction of 93%. Conclusion The RDU in our hospital has become a vital section for the management and post-procedure caring of patients undergoing interventional procedures in the Radiology Service with low complication rates and overall high levels of quality and patient safety, allowing the reduction of waiting lists and occupancy rates

    The current recommendation for the management of isolated high-grade prostatic intraepithelial neoplasia

    Get PDF
    Altres ajuts: Acord transformatiu CRUE-CSICObjective: To analyse the current predictive value of isolated high-grade prostatic intraepithelial neoplasia (HGPIN) for clinically significant prostate cancer (csPCa) detection in repeat biopsies. Patients and Methods: A cohort of 293 men with isolated HGPIN detected in previous biopsies performed without multiparametric magnetic resonance imaging (mpMRI), and who underwent repeat biopsy within 1 to 3 years, was analysed. Pre-repeat biopsy mpMRI and guided biopsies to suspicious lesions (Prostate Imaging - Reporting and Data System [PI-RADS] ≥3) and/or and systematic biopsies were performed. Persistent prostate cancer (PCa) suspicion, defined as sustained serum prostatespecific antigen level >4 ng/mL and/or abnormal digital rectal examination, was present in 248 men (84.6%), and was absent in 45 men (15.4%). A control group of 190 men who had no previous HGPIN, atypical small acinar proliferation or HGPIN with atypia who were scheduled to undergo repeat biopsy due to persistent PCa suspicion were also analysed. csPCa was defined as tumours of Grade Group ≥2.Results: In the subset of 45 men with isolated HGPIN, in whom PCa suspicion disappeared, only one csPCa (2.2%) and one insignificant PCa (iPCa) were detected. csPCa was detected in 34.7% of men with persistent PCa suspicion and previous HGPIN, and in 28.4% of those without previous HGPIN (P =0.180). iPCa was detected in 12.1% and 6.3%, respectively (P =0.039). Logistic regression analysis showed that the risk of csPCa detection was not predicted by previous HGPIN: odds ratio (OR) 1.369 (95% confidence interval [CI] 0.894-2.095; P =0.149); however, previous HGPIN increased the risk of iPCa detection: OR 2.043 (95% CI 1.016-4.109; P =0.006). Conclusion: The risk of csPCa in men with isolated HGPIN, in whom PCa suspicion disappears, is extremely low. Moreover, in those men in whom PCa suspicion persists, the risk of csPCa is not influenced by the previous finding of HGPIN. However, previous HGPIN increases the risk of iPCa detection. Therefore, repeat prostate biopsy should not be recommended solely because of a previous HGPIN

    Genome-wide analysis of signaling networks regulating fatty acid–induced gene expression and organelle biogenesis

    Get PDF
    Reversible phosphorylation is the most common posttranslational modification used in the regulation of cellular processes. This study of phosphatases and kinases required for peroxisome biogenesis is the first genome-wide analysis of phosphorylation events controlling organelle biogenesis. We evaluate signaling molecule deletion strains of the yeast Saccharomyces cerevisiae for presence of a green fluorescent protein chimera of peroxisomal thiolase, formation of peroxisomes, and peroxisome functionality. We find that distinct signaling networks involving glucose-mediated gene repression, derepression, oleate-mediated induction, and peroxisome formation promote stages of the biogenesis pathway. Additionally, separate classes of signaling proteins are responsible for the regulation of peroxisome number and size. These signaling networks specify the requirements of early and late events of peroxisome biogenesis. Among the numerous signaling proteins involved, Pho85p is exceptional, with functional involvements in both gene expression and peroxisome formation. Our study represents the first global study of signaling networks regulating the biogenesis of an organelle

    Safety of Obtaining an Extra Biobank Kidney Biopsy Core

    Get PDF
    Biobank; Chronic kidney disease; Kidney biopsyBiobanco; Enfermedad renal cronica; Biopsia renalBiobanc; Malaltia renal crònica; Biòpsia de ronyóBackground and objectives: Kidney biopsy (KB) is the “gold standard” for the diagnosis of nephropathies and it is a diagnostic tool that presents a low rate of complications. Nowadays, biobank collections of renal tissue of patients with proven renal pathology are essential for research in nephrology. To provide enough tissue for the biobank collection, it is usually needed to obtain an extra kidney core at the time of kidney biopsy. The objective of our study is to evaluate the complications after KB and to analyze whether obtaining an extra core increases the risk of complications. Material and methods: Prospective observational study of KBs performed at Vall d’Hebron Hospital between 2019 and 2020. All patients who accepted to participate to our research biobank of native kidney biopsies were included to the study. Clinical and laboratory data were reviewed and we studied risk factors associated with complications. Results: A total of 221 patients were included, mean age 56.6 (±16.8) years, 130 (58.8%) were men, creatinine was 2.24 (±1.94) mg/dL, proteinuria 1.56 (0.506–3.590) g/24 h, hemoglobin 12.03 (±2.3) g/dL, INR 0.99 (±0.1), and prothrombin time (PT) 11.86 (±1.2) s. A total of 38 patients (17.2%) presented complications associated with the procedure: 13.1% were minor complications, 11.3% (n = 25) required blood transfusion, 1.4% (n = 3) had severe hematomas, 2.3% (n = 5) required embolization, and 0.5% (n = 1) presented arterio-venous fistula. An increased risk for complication was independently associated with obtaining a single kidney core (vs. 2 and 3 cores) (p = 0.021). Conclusions: KB is an invasive and safe procedure with a low percentage of complications.     Who with suspected prostate cancer can benefit from Proclarix after multiparametric magnetic resonance imaging?

    Get PDF
    Cathepsin D; Magnetic resonance imaging; ProclarixCatepsina D; Imatges per ressonància magnètica; ProclarixCatepsina D; Imágenes por resonancia magnética; ProclarixProclarix is a new blood-based test to assess the likelihood of clinically significant prostate cancer (csPCa) defined as >2 grade group. In this study, we analyzed whether Proclarix and PSA density (PSAD) could improve the selection of candidates for prostate biopsy after multiparametric magnetic resonance imaging (mpMRI). Proclarix and PSAD were assessed in 567 consecutive men with suspected PCa in whom pre-biopsy 3 Tesla mpMRI, scoring with Prostate Imaging-Report and Data System (PI-RADS) v.2, and guided and/or systematic biopsies were performed. Proclarix and PSAD thresholds having csPCa sensitivity over 90% were found at 10% and 0.07 ng/(mL*cm3), respectively. Among 100 men with negative mpMRI (PI-RADS <3), csPCa was detected in 6 cases, which would have been undetected if systematic biopsies were avoided. However, Proclarix suggested performing a biopsy on 70% of men with negative mpMRI. In contrast, PSAD only detected 50% of csPCa and required 71% of prostate biopsies. In 169 men with PI-RADS 3, Proclarix avoided 21.3% of prostate biopsies and detected all 25 cases of csPCa, while PSAD avoided 26.3% of biopsies, but missed 16% of csPCa. In 190 men with PI-RADS 4 and 108 with PI-RADS 5, Proclarix avoided 12.1% and 5.6% of prostate biopsies, but missed 4.8% and 1% of csPCa, respectively. PSAD avoided 18.4% and 9.3% of biopsies, but missed 11.4% and 4.2% csPCa, respectively.     The Efficacy of Proclarix to Select Appropriate Candidates for Magnetic Resonance Imaging and Derived Prostate Biopsies in Men with Suspected Prostate Cancer

    Get PDF
    Diagnosis; Proclarix; Prostate cancerDiagnóstico; Proclarix; Cáncer de próstataDiagnòstic; Proclarix; Càncer de pròstataPurpose To analyze how Proclarix is valuable to appropriately select candidates for multiparametric magnetic resonance imaging (mpMRI) and derived biopsies, among men with suspected prostate cancer (PCa). Proclarix is a new marker computing the clinically significant PCa (csPCa) risk, based on serum thosmbospondin-1, cathepsin D, prostate-specific antigen (PSA) and percent free PSA, in addition to age, that has been developed in men with serum PSA 2 to 10 ng/mL, prostate volume ≥35 mL, and normal digital rectal examination (DRE). Materials and Methods Proclarix score (0%–100%) is analyzed in a prospective frozen serum collection of 517 correlative men scheduled for guided and/or systematic biopsies after mpMRI. Outcome variables were csPCa detection (grade group ≥2), insignificant PCa (iPCa) overdetection and avoided mpMRIs. Results The area under the curve of Proclarix was 0.701 (95% CI 0.637–0.765) among 281 men with serum PSA 2 to 10 ng/mL, prostate volume ≥35 mL, and -normal DRE, and 0.754 (95% CI 0.701–0.807) in the others, p=0.038. Net benefit of Proclarix existed in all men. After selecting 10% threshold, Proclarix was integrated in an algorithm which also used the serum PSA level and DRE. A reduction of 25.4% of mpMRIs request was observed and 17.7% of prostate biopsies. Overdetection of iPCa was reduced in 18.2% and 2.6% of csPCa were misdiagnosed. Conclusions Proclarix is valuable in all men with suspected PCa. An algorithm integrating Proclarix score, serum PSA, and DRE can avoid mpMRI requests, unnecessary prostate biopsies and iPCa overdetection, with minimal loss of csPCa detection
